    Research on Highway Roadside Safety by Guozhu Cheng, Rui Cheng, Yulong Pei, Juan Han

    Published 2021-01-01
    “…According to the number of times mentioned in the literature, the first five significant risk factors that cause frequent roadside accidents are small-radius curves, heavy traffic, objects adjacent to the lane (such as poles and trees), narrow lanes, and narrow shoulders, and the first five significant risk factors that cause fatal roadside accidents are driver age ≤25 or ≥65, alcohol, speeding, failure to use seat belts, and heavy trucks. …”

    Research on the generalized utility max-min fair algorithm based on piecewise linear function by XU Tong, LIAO Jian-xin

    Published 2006-01-01
    “…A generalized utility max-min(UMM) fair algorithm of resource allocation based on piecewise linear function was provided,which supported the upper/lower bounds of resource allocation as well as strictly increasing and continu-ous utility functions.Because of the avoidance of iterative procedure,this algorithm was less complex than water-filling,another UMM fair algorithm.And its simplified version had the same complexity as the narrow-sense UMM fair algo-rithm based on piecewise linear function.This algorithm can be applied in various problems of resource allocation in the field of computer and communication.…”

    Password authentication scheme for mobile computing environment by LIU Jun, LIAO Jian-xin, ZHU Xiao-min, WANG Chun

    Published 2007-01-01
    “…By means of IC(integrated circuit) card,RSA cryptography,and discrete logarithm,a password authentication scheme for mobile computing environment was presented.No verification tables were preserved at the server side to consolidate the security.To be applicable for the mobile computing environment,the scheme was designed as a one-roundtrip protocol to meet the computation-constraint terminals and narrow-bandwidth radio interface.Moreover,the passwords in use could be changed by users without any interaction with servers over the radio.The performance of the scheme was measured by making use of M/G/1/N queuing model and compared with that of TLS.…”
